Oracle Text
All Sliver creatures have "Whenever a creature dealt damage by this creature this turn dies, put a +1/+1 counter on this creature."

Card Rulings
- July 1, 2013
If the creature type of a Sliver changes so it’s no longer a Sliver, it will no longer be affected by its own ability. Its ability will continue to affect other Sliver creatures.
Source: wotc - July 1, 2013
Abilities that Slivers grant, as well as power/toughness boosts, are cumulative. However, for some abilities, like flying, having more than one instance of the ability doesn’t provide any additional benefit.
Source: wotc - September 25, 2006
If Vampiric Sliver is put into a graveyard from the battlefield at the same time as a creature dealt damage by another Sliver, the Vampiric Sliver’s ability will trigger for the other Sliver. That Sliver will get a +1/+1 counter.
Source: wotc - September 25, 2006
If a Sliver doesn’t have this ability when it deals damage, but does have it when the damaged creature is put into a graveyard, the ability will trigger.
Source: wotc - September 25, 2006
If a Sliver has this ability when it deals damage, but not when the damaged creature is put into a graveyard, nothing happens.
